PLAY MORE, DIET LESS
Cutting fat may have more to do with staying active than restricting your calories, according to a review in Research Quarterly for Exercise and Sport. Engaging in vigorous high-impact activity, such as running or playing an intense game of flag football, researchers found, causes mechanical stimulation of stem cells, resulting in their development into lean tissue rather than fat. That is, because the body recognizes the need for more muscle and bone to support your strenuous activity level, it converts these fledgling tissues into exactly that. Bottom line: To get leaner, emphasize exercise over cutting calories.

CROSS=FIT
CrossFit kicks ass: Thats the conclusion of a new study published in the Journal of Strength and Conditioning Research. In it, 54 subjects (all regular Paleo eaters, to rule out major nutritional variants) performed CrossFit-style high-intensity power training
(HIPT) workouts for 10 weeks. Although a few subjects dropped out with injuries, tests showed that the remaining men and women gained muscle, lost body fat, and improved aerobic fitnesssuggesting that, used safely, CrossFit can greatly improve aerobic health and body composition.

JAVA SCRIPT
We already know moderate coffee consumption can have a positive effect on heart health, cognitive function, and longevity. Now theres evidence it can also fight off liver disease. According to research presented at the 2013 Digestive Disease Week medical conference, regular coffee consumption or even as little as a few cups a monthcan diminish the risk of primary sclerosing cholangitis, or PSCan autoimmune disease that can lead to cirrhosis of the liver.
BEHIND ON SLEEP?
Yet another important reason to get enough rest: According to new research, people who have difficulty sleeping are twice as likely to develop prostate cancer than sound sleepers. The fiveyear study, reported in Cancer Epidemiology, Biomarkers & Prevention, found more than a threefold increase in risk for advanced prostate cancer associated with very severe sleep problems. Sleep may be a potential [means of] intervention to reduce the risk of prostate cancer, says Lara G. Sigurdardttir, M.D., of the University of Iceland. SODA? METH? ITS ALL THE SAME TO YOUR TEETH
You wouldnt expect to see your favorite soft drink on a list of illicit drugs like meth and crackbut thats where your dentist would like to put it. A University of Michigan study compared the mouths of an admitted methamphetamine user, a longtime crack cocaine user, and an excessive soda drinker (two liters a day for three to five years); subjects also had poor oral hygiene. The same type and severity of tooth erosion was found in all participants mouths, due to the consumption of highly acidic substancesi.e., the corrosive ingredients used to make meth and crack, or the citric acid contained in soda. So grab a juice or water, and leave the fizzy stuff alone.

You dont have to train for long to pick up the lingo: Three sets of 10, Back and bis, and Its all you, bro! are terms that get thrown around in every weight room, and theyre easy to interpret. But theres one concept that tends to confuse lifters. Were talking about supersets, bro.
SUPER TIME-SAVER
Supersets make your workout more timeefficient. Lets say you pair up bench presses and seated cable rows, done for three supersets of five reps each and resting only 60 seconds between all sets; youd need about seven minutes to complete all your sets, and in that time you wouldve thoroughly worked your upper body. Compare that with training chest and back separately with conventional straight sets, using 90-second rest periods. This would take you some 10 minutes. A three-minute time save may not sound like much, but the more you replace straight sets with supersets, the faster youll go.

UN-MOBILE HOMES
Maybe a headhunter is looking at your LinkedIn profile at this very moment, about to help you land the dream job that will take your career to the next level. But if the gig they offer is in San Francisco and youre saddled with a condo in Atlanta thats worth substantially less than you paid for it, youve got an expensive decision ahead of you. In fact, economists say that the lack of housing mobility is part of the reason unemployment has been so stubbornly high. Some guys find they literally cannot afford to take a job in a new location, because if they sold their house theyd owe the bank money. Its something we haven't seen much of since the Great Depression, Russell Price, senior economist at Ameriprise Financial Services, told Reuters. In 2011, only 11.6% of the population made a significant movea record low, according to the Census Bureau. Last year that number ticked up slightly. When you buy a place, youre paying for the right to sink nails in the walls and replace those hideous purple tiles in the bathroomin short, to set down roots. But that cuts both ways. When you invest in a community, you may close the door, ever so slightly, on opportunities awaiting you in the rest of the world. Imagine if Mark Zuckerberg had been tied to a loft in Beantown and couldnt just up and ditch it for Silicon Valley. Facebook might still be a novelty thing Harvard kids use to get dates, and the rest of us would be stuck with Google+. I know a woman who left a good job and a rental apartment to move to New York so she could be near her boyfriend. When she got here, she met me, dumped the boyfriend, and now shes my wife. Child No. 3 is on the way. Serendipity can be a good thing. Give it room to run.

Just don't go too crazy. Following impulses is great, except when it comes to mortgages. You should never think about investing in a home unless you expect to stay put for at least five years. Any less than that and the costs associated with buying a placeclosing costs, interest, that new couchwill outweigh any potential savings. Not to mention prices could pull back again, especially if mortgage rates rise.
CALCULATING RISK
But theres another side to the real estate decision: the math side. Unlike my renovating friend, the numbers are now in your favor. Thanks to the bursting of the bubble and the Federal Reserves push to lower interest rates, you can purchase a depressed asset with other peoples money at less than 4.5%. Thats a pretty sweet deal. The crash, in fact, turned the rent-or-buy equation upside down. In many cities, its now cheaper to buy than to rent. In Chicago, for example, Deutsche Bank analysts
WorldMags.net
WorldMags.net
determined that, back in 2006, renting was about 40% cheaper than owning. Then, when the buying stopped and more people started renting, landlords naturally jacked up prices, even as the cost of purchasing apartments fell. By 2012, it was nearly 50% more expensive to rent than buy. You can check the rent:buy ratio on the website trulia.com. With mortgages at 4.5%, the research firm estimates that its 43% cheaper to buy than rent in Miami, 17% cheaper in New York, and 9% cheaper in San Francisco. The basic formula is this: Divide the cost of a property by the annual (12 months) rent. If the number is more than 15, renting is the better deal. Less than 15, call a realtor. Once again, however, its important to impose a little reality on that theory. Calculators like Trulias assume youd rent the same-size place youd buy. In fact, the odds are youd rent a smaller place. Buying is a long-term decision, so naturally you spend a little extra so that youve got room to grow. Nothing inherently wrong with that choice, but it means a little more of your
A HOUSE IS A FORCED SAVINGS ACCOUNT. AS USC PROFESSOR RICHARD GREEN PUTS IT, YOU GET TO LIVE IN YOUR PIGGY BANK.
savings goes toward shelter, leaving you that much less cash.
HOME BANKING
My dad always told me that buying is a better deal than renting because real estate is an investment. Renting, he says, is throwing money out the window. Hes right, but for the wrong reason. In case the epic housing crash we just lived through didnt make it clear, real estate is never going to be a surefire moneymaker. Yale economist Robert J. Shiller has estimated that during the 100 years leading up to 1990before the boomhome prices in the U.S. rose only 0.2% a year, on average, after inflation. By contrast, the stock market has consistently returned 57% after inflation,
depending on whose investment numbers you ultimately use. Its always dangerous to extrapolate from past performance to predict the future, but this one isnt a fair fight. If you were to rent (a smaller place) for the rest of your life, and plowed every cent you saved into a low-cost index fund that tracks the total stock market, statistics show youd always end up richer than if you invested in a house. But do you have the discipline to do that? Most people dont. Instead, spending increases right along with discretionary income, so you buy nicer clothes and better cars, you join a fancier gym and eat at finer restaurants. After 30 or 40 years you have the same amount of savings, but instead of owning your home outright, youre still paying rent. In the end, its not about economics, but discipline. The single-best reason to buy a house is that its a forced savings account. As USC Professor Richard Green puts it, You get to live in your piggy bank. The American dream is alive and well. Just dont rush it.

CIRCUIT TRAINING
Back-to-back exercises burn fat and save time
OCircuit training is a series of weighted, body-weight, or aerobic exercises grouped together with little or no rest in between. Though an age-old concept in fitness, its never been hotter than it is now. Go to any gym and youll see trainers taking clients through circuits; exercise classes are also based around them. When it comes to resistance training for fat loss, circuits are tough to beat, says Dan Trink, director of training operations at Peak Performance, one of New York Citys most high-end gyms. Circuit-training programs use a wide variety of exercises, ensuring that you work all movement patterns. And the short rest intervals are a great way of driving up metabolic demand. The research seems to support circuit training, too, at least from an efficiency standpoint. A study in the Journal of Strength and Conditioning Research compared performing exercises in circuit fashion (resting 35 seconds between sets) with a more passive approach (three minutes rest between sets). The circuit workouts took less time but still offered similar improvements in strength and power.

Strongman
Lifting odd objects builds real-world strength and endurance
OWhy would you want to work out like those behemoths you see on the Worlds Strongest Man on ESPN? Strongman training is the most functional type of training there is, says Hans Pirman, owner of Global Strongman Gym in New York City. Youre using your whole body as one unit, to be as efficient as possiblethe endurance and strength you gain are tremendous. Strongman is the sport of lifting, pulling, and carrying oversize objectsfrom stones and logs to cars and planes. You can practice it for fitness in a dedicated strongman gym like Pirmans or modify it for a more conventional health club. You can pick up a pair of heavy dumbbells and walk across the gym and backfast, Pirman says. Called the farmers walk, this exercise builds grip and core strength while sending your heart rate soaring.
T H E P R O S : Strongman builds muscle as well as conditioning. It closes up your weak points, too, says Pirman. If youve been bench pressing then switch to pressing a log overhead, the strength you gain will make the bench press feel easy when you go back to it. T H E C O N S : Unsurprisingly, strongman exercises pose a risk for injury and may not be appropriate for people who are already banged up. At the same time, remember that the total-body strength youll build can also help prevent injuries down the line.
You dont have to join a strongman club, says Smith. Incorporating more full-body exercises and moves like the farmers walk into your existing routine will build functional strength.
T H E TA K E A W AY:

OJapanese researcher Izumi Tabata examined two groups of speed skatersone using moderate-intensity intervals to improve conditioning and the other using high-intensity intervals. He found that not only did the latter improve in both aerobic and anaerobic fitness to a greater degree, they were able to do it in workouts lasting a mere four minutes. The Tabata protocol, as its become known, has you perform any cardiovascular exercise as hard as possible for 20 seconds, rest 10 seconds, then repeat for eight total rounds (four minutes). A kind of HIIT, Tabata accelerates the metabolic rate, so its also become known for its potential to burn fat as well as improve conditioning.

Prime Time
The three most crucial times to eat your protein Before a Meal
The metabolic effects of protein can be immediate, especially when it comes to weight loss. One study published in Nutrition & Metabolism found that having 10 grams of whey protein twice daily before a meal boosted weight loss by 42% after 12 weeks. Consuming protein before a meal jump-starts the satiety sequence and may also cause an early release in hormones that support more efficient metabolism.
After Exercise
Pumping protein into your system right after you hit the gym is crucial for halting excessive muscle damage, jump-starting the recovery process, and flipping the metabolic musclebuilding switch. Moreover, in 2006 an Australian study published in the European Journal of Applied Physiology found that consuming carbohydrates along with your post-workout protein enhances muscle building and recovery.
Midafternoon Snack
Having a protein-rich midafternoon snack can help stabilize your blood sugar levels, boost muscle building, and also dampen your brains drive to make you snack on refined carbs and sugar-laden snacks later in the day. Protein intake initiates the production of hormones that interact with different areas of the brain to curb hunger and cravings by increasing satiety and preventing your need to reward yourself with bad food.
CASEIN. Casein makes up 80% of the protein found in milk. Its found in higher concentrations in cottage cheese and Greek yogurt. Caseins unique effects arise from how its absorbed and digested. Unlike whey, casein is absorbed slowly, increasing but not spiking blood amino-acid levels. Caseins anti-catabolic properties result from these sustained increases in blood amino-acid levels, which is ideal for optimizing the balance between muscle breakdown and muscle building. Research shows that casein eaten late at night can improve muscle building and recovery from exercise while you sleep.

QUINOA. Quinoa is an ancient grain famous for its protein content. Unlike most grains, quinoa contains all nine essential amino acidsthe amino acids that your body cant make; theyre also key for muscle building. Quinoa contains three more grams of protein per cup than brown rice, and brown rice doesnt contain all the essential amino acids. That said, quinoa still contains only eight grams of protein per cup, so it shouldnt be considered a meals primary protein source.
t its most basic level, protein is made up of a string of biochemical units called amino acids. The presence and abundance of different amino acids vary from food to food, which is why living on raw eggs and whey powder will hamper, not enhance, your muscle-building ability. Incorporating a variety of protein sources into your diet ensures that you get all the different amino acids you need. And thats a good thing, because for the best results you should be eating lots of proteinall the time. A common myth about protein is that your body can handle only so much in any given day. Wrong. In fact, more than doubling the recommended dietary allowance of protein so that you take in approximately one gram of protein per pound of body weight will improve not just your body composition and shrink your waistline but, according to a study published in the Journal of the American Medical Association, it can also reduce your risk of cardiovascular disease. Research shows that in order to optimize protein synthesis, or muscle building, you need to spread your daily protein consumption over 34 meals, not 12 big protein-rich meals or 67 small meals throughout the day.

One of the first things you learn when you start lifting weights is how important it is to use a full range of motion on exercises. Thats how you work the entire muscle and avoid developing imbalances that can reduce your flexibility and cause injuries later on. This remains sound advice, and if youre a relative beginner to resistance training, you should follow that rule. But if youve been lifting for a few years, it may be time to break it.
PARTIAL CREDIT
Next time you hit the gym, act like your rst girlfriend and dont go all the way. Instead, try using quarter reps to build strength and size. By Dan Trink, C.S.C.S.
DIRECTIONS
Perform each workout (Day I, II, and III) once per week, resting at least a day between each session. Exercises marked A and B are paired and alternated. So, youll do one set of A, rest, then one set of B, rest, and repeat until all sets are complete. Then go on to the next pair.
HOW IT WORKS Part of getting bigger means getting stronger, and after youve milked the quick gains every beginner enjoys, it gets harder to add weight to the bar. Performing only part of a repusually the top-quarter range of motionallows you to break this plateau. Its easier to handle heavier weight when youre doing only the first quarter of a rep, such as coming down just a few inches on the squat. Called a partial rep, this isnt necessarily cheating. When you use very heavy weights for a partial, you stimulate your central nervous system to recruit more muscle fibers. This then convinces your body that youre actually stronger, and youll find that you can handle heavier weights when you go back to using a full range of motion. The workouts that follow take advantage of this trick, alternating heavy partial-rep sets with heavy full-range ones for big gains in strength and the muscle growth that will inevitably follow.

If I were going to be the best, I would leave no possibility unexplored. And so when Dr. Cetojevic approached me with theories that to many of us might sound far-fetched, I was ready to listen. At that bizarre and shocking moment when my arm struggled under his pressure, I realized that the bread I was holding against my stomach was like kryptonite. I was ready to make some changes immediately. But the idea of giving up bread and other gluten-containing foodsfoods that were so precious to me, so ingrained in my life, my family, and my culturewas scary. Then Dr. Cetojevic explained that I shouldnt pledge to give up bread forever. As the saying goes, forever is a very long time. Two weeks, he said. You give it up for 14 days, and then you call me. It was hard at first. I craved the soft, chewy, comforting feel of bread. I craved crunchy pizza dough, sweet rolls, and all the foods that I learned contained wheatthings I had never suspected. For the first 10 days or so, I craved these foods, but I focused each day And I pledged that from that moment on, whatever my body told me, Id listen.
O O O
and, especially, a lot of bread. Bread is an important part of Serbian tradition, and when you are in wartime, bread is literally life; for many of us, during the NATO bombing of the late 90s, there were times when it was all we had to eat. I know what its like to have a family of five people with just 10 euros to sustain us; you buy oil, sugar, flourthe cheapest stuff and you make bread. One kilo of bread can stretch over three or four days. Even though my family never went truly hungry, for many, many months we lived having electricity and running water for only an hour or two a day. Bread sustained us. Even when times were good, it was always there for us. Because Serbia is close to Italy, Italian cuisine is a strong influence, so when we werent eating bread, we were eating pasta and, especially in my family, pizza. The Djokovic pizza parlor was our main source of income for most of my childhood, and, of course, it was home base for my earliest days at the tennis court across the street, where my lifes journey began. In other words, you may love wheat, rye, and other grains that go into making traditional breads, pastas, and pastries. But I promise, you dont love them more than I did. Its quite possible that, because I relied on bread and dairy for so much of my young life, my body became increasingly sensitive to them. When were young, our bodies can work through a lot of the challenges we present to it. Thats a blessing, but its also a curse. When youre young and strong, you can fight through the bad food, the stress, without necessarily getting sick or fatigued. But as we get older, and we stick to the same way of eating and living, we begin to experience problems. We need to make changes in the way we eat. The changes arent that hard. And the rewards can be astonishing. I said at age 6 that I wanted to be No. 1 in the world, and by some miracle, my first coach, Jelena Gencic, took me seriously. She also believed that being the very best meant studying much more than just tennis. She became a partner with my family in my intellectual upbringing. The world around us was changing, and the communism we were born under was crumbling. My parents understood that the future would be a very different place, and that it was important for their children to become students of the world. Listening to classical music, reading poetry, thinking intensely about the human conditionthis was part of my early training. It was in part because of this upbringing that I continued through my early life to explore every kind of conditioning I could find, from tai chi to yoga, and to seek out new expertise.
138 MENS FITNESS SEPTEMBER 2013
The changes arent that hard. And the rewards are astonishing.
on staying disciplined; and, fortunately, my family and friendseven though they thought I was crazysupported me in my quest. But as the days rolled along, I began to feel different. I felt lighter, more energetic. The nighttime stuffiness I had lived with for 15 years suddenly disappeared. By the end of the first week, I no longer wanted rolls and cookies and breads; it was as if a lifelong craving had miraculously abated. Every day I woke up feeling as though Id had the best nights sleep of my life. I was beginning to believe. And thats when Dr. Cetojevic suggested I eat a bagel. This was the true test, he explained. Eliminate a food for 14 days, then eat it and see what happens. And remarkably, the day after I introduced gluten back into my diet, I felt like Id spent the night drinking whiskey! I was sluggish getting out of bed, just as I had been during my teenage years. I was dizzy. My stuffiness was back. I felt as though Id woken up with a hangover. This is the proof, the doctor said. This is what your body is giving you to show you its intolerant.
BEING A PROFESSIONAL TENNIS player can be a very good life, or it can be very hard indeed. Te n n i s i s ve r y d i f f e re n t f ro m t e a m sports. It can be extremely lonely and very discouragingmore like being a musician than an athlete. There are nearly 2,000 male players ranked by the Association of Tennis Professionals (ATP). Many of us, when we first start, are scrounging for dollars to support our profession, and to pay our way from one tournament to the next, because if you dont win, you dont get paid. Once you have some degree of success, however, the living gets lavish. Traditionally, tennis, like golf, has been a sport that relies more on training, skill, and natural talent than on physical conditioning. At the peaks of their careers, people like Pete Sampras and Andre Agassi were fit, but they focused more on skill than on diet and fitness. Even today, among the top 200 players in the world, many still eat whatever they want, dont think much about training other than the time they spend on the court, and enjoy their successand all the indulgences it can buyto the fullest. You can travel the world, make a million dollars a year, and have a very nice life if you have the natural skills and the dedication to be a top tennis pro. But once you get into the top 40 or so, things changeproper fitness and nutrition become fundamental. The best players serve at speeds of more than 135 miles an hour, and forehands regularly top 80 miles an hour. Top seeds like Rafael Nadal, Roger Federer, Jo-Wilfried Tsonga, and Andy Murray are probably stronger, faster, and fitter than any tennis players who have ever strode the court before. Were like precision instruments: If I am even the slightest bit offif my body is reacting poorly to the foods Ive eatenI simply cant play at the level it takes to beat these guys. More important, I cant be the friend, the brother, the son, the boyfriend, or the man I want to be, either. Eating the right foods gives me more than physical stamina; it gives me patience, focus, and a positive attitude. It allows me to be in the moment on the court, but also with the people I love. It lets me play at FOR A the highest level in every realm DETAILED of life. EATING PLAN BASED ON I bet you want to play at your DJOKOVICS highest level. DIET, SEE PAGE 109. Then here is my suggestion: Begin by changing the foods you eat.

Creatine decoded
Learn the truth about the most popular muscle supplement By Sean Hyson, C.S.C.S.
CREATINE IS THE BEST-SELLING SPORTS supplement in history. Introduced in 1993, its become as much a part of gym culture as dumbbells or spandex. But the 20 years since its debut have done little to clear up misinformation on the subject. Heres the real deal on the stuff, sans the sales pitch:
WHAT IT IS: Creatine monohydrate is a chemical naturally produced in the body and stored in muscle. It can also be obtained by eating fish and meat (particularly beef ). As a sports supplement, its primarily sold in powder form (its white). HOW IT WORKS:
The more interesting areas to me are creatines impact on various disease states. Studies have credited creatine with furtherreaching health benefits, such as slowing the symptoms of Parkinsons disease and loss of sight, although this hasnt been proven. In 2012, an Australian study looked at creatine supplementation on vegans and vegetarians (a population unlikely to get creatine from diet alone). It found that creatine improved memory and intelligence measures that required processing speed in both groups.
DRAWBACKS:
Okay, pay attention. The fuel your body makes from the carbs, protein, and fat you eat is called adenosine triphosphate (ATP). This is the energy source that drives muscle contractions. When you work out, muscle contractions cause one of the phosphates in ATP molecules to oxidize, converting it to adenosine diphosphate (ADP), which is useless to the body unless it can be changed back into ATP. This is where creatine comes in. Creatine monohydrate contains phosphate. It works with ADP to make ATP again. When your muscles are refueled with ATP, youll be able to perform extra reps and experience stronger muscle contractions during training.
Creatine has been blamed for a host of problems from cramping to kidney trouble, but these claims are unproven. Creatine is one of the most well-researched, most effective, and safest supplements to date, Mohr says. The main drawback is that it may cause weight gain due to water retention, and some may not want that.
BENEFITS:
Creatine is widely seen as effective for increasing performance in high-intensity exercise, such as weight training and sprinting. It causes some water retention, so it can increase body weight as well, which is useful for gaining strength. The performance data are solid and well established, says Chris Mohr, Ph.D., a nutritionist and author (mohrresults.com).
HOW TO USE IT: Creatine monohydrate can be purchased in plain form by itself or as part of a formula that contains other ingredients. The typical prescription is to load creatine for five days by ingesting 20 grams per day (broken up into doses of three to five grams per serving). Afterward, a maintenance dose of three to five grams can be taken to keep muscle creatine levels high. However, Mohr says this is unnecessary. You can start with the maintenance dose of five grams per day, and youll reap the same benefits. Be wary of fancy creatine products that promise better results. There is no reliable research to show that other creatine formulations have any advantage over plain creatine monohydrate.
